Solder Alloy 115 vs. Grade 19 Titanium

Solder alloy 115 belongs to the otherwise unclassified metals classification, while grade 19 titanium belongs to the titanium alloys. There are 22 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(10,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is solder alloy 115 and the bottom bar is grade 19 titanium.
